Amid a rise in the number of complaints of illegal parking in the city, the Kolkata Municipal Corporation (KMC) has launched a mobile application to check the problem.
“The application is developed using the latest technology to identify wrongly parked vehicles. The number, image, and GPS location of the defaulting vehicle will be shared with the municipality as well as the Transport Department through the application,” said an official.
Thereafter, the vehicle owners will be informed about the penalty through a message on their mobile phone. The penalty for illegal parking is Rs 1,000.
“The problem of illegal parking has grown manifold in the past two years. We have identified several illegal-parking hotspots,” the official added.
Some of the worst-affected areas when it comes to wrong parking are Burrabazar, Strand Road, BBD Bag, Esplanade, Chandni Chowk, Rabindra Sarani, Bidhan Sarani, Chittaranjan Avenue, AJC Bose Road, College Street, Surjya Sen Street, Kidderpore, Behala, Bhowanipore, Tollygunge, Gariahat, Lake Gardens and Jadavpur.
